Jamstack y Headless CMS: La combinación perfecta
22 de junio de 2023

Jamstack y Headless CMS: La combinación perfecta

Por Asdrúbal Chirinos

Jamstack es una arquitectura de desarrollo web moderna que está ganando cada vez más popularidad. Esta arquitectura se basa en tres pilares principales: JavaScript, APIs y la presentación de páginas pre-generadas (Markup) en vez de en tiempo real. Esta combinación de tecnologías permite que las páginas se carguen más rápidamente y se sientan más rápidas para los usuarios, lo que mejora la experiencia del usuario y el SEO.

Pero ¿qué relación tiene Jamstack con los Headless CMS? Los Headless CMS son sistemas de gestión de contenido que permiten a los desarrolladores separar la presentación del contenido de la lógica de negocio. En otras palabras, el contenido se almacena en una base de datos y se entrega a través de una API a cualquier dispositivo o plataforma que lo solicite. Esto permite que los desarrolladores tengan un mayor control sobre cómo se presenta el contenido, lo que facilita la creación de sitios web con la arquitectura Jamstack.

Una de las ventajas de utilizar un Headless CMS con Jamstack es que permite a los desarrolladores crear contenido personalizado y atractivo para los usuarios sin tener que preocuparse por la lógica de negocio. Los desarrolladores pueden centrarse en crear una experiencia de usuario única y personalizada, mientras que la lógica de negocio se maneja por separado. Además, los Headless CMS son altamente escalables y permiten a los desarrolladores crear contenido en una variedad de formatos.

Otra ventaja de utilizar un Headless CMS con Jamstack es la seguridad. Al separar la presentación del contenido de la lógica de negocio, se reduce el riesgo de que el contenido se vea comprometido por un ataque. Además, los Headless CMS a menudo ofrecen una serie de herramientas de seguridad para proteger el contenido y prevenir el acceso no autorizado.

En resumen, Jamstack y los Headless CMS son una combinación poderosa para la creación de sitios web modernos. La separación de la presentación del contenido de la lógica de negocio permite a los desarrolladores crear sitios web personalizados y atractivos, al mismo tiempo que ofrece una mayor escalabilidad y seguridad.

Compartir:

¿Te gustó este artículo? Apoya mi trabajo y ayúdame a seguir creando contenido.

Cómprame un café